What Are Dreams for?


One theory is that we dream to release the deep, secret desires. / Another theory


is that dreams allow us to solve problems / that we can



t solve in real life. / We go to


sleep with a problem and wake up with the solution. / If you believe that your dreams


are important, / then analyzing them may help you to focus on the problem / and help


you to find the solution. / The modern image is that dreams are the brain’s way of


cleaning up the computer’s hard disk. / Dreams organize the events of the day into


folders / and delete what is not needed.

Teaching Methods for Effective Communication


Good evening



everyone. A few months later



you will start to teach


international students. Today



we will talk about the teaching methods of effective


communication.


Teaching methods can help increase communication effectiveness. Clearly


organizing ideas and writing an outline on the chalkboard that lists the main points to


be covered during the class helps students follow along with the organization of ideas.


(1) It is also very helpful for students when teachers write technical terms or


theoretical concepts on the board as they are mentioned. Students need and appreciate


this effort.


Student participation in the international teacher’s classroom is necessary. (2)


By


setting aside class time for students to explain and discuss their understanding of the


course material and the teacher's lecture or explanations?


many communication errors


can be corrected before they interfere with student learning.


Of course



some difficulties may be assumed to result from language problems


when in fact the problem lies elsewhere. (3) When students don



t understand



it


could be a language problem, but it also could be that the teacher doesn



t have good


teaching skills.


So it’s important to communicate with students to find out what the


problem is.


Using effective teaching methods does facilitate classroom communication. As


teachers with teaching experience in their native countries already know, when


lecturing, it is important to clearly state each point before speaking about it, make the


point and then summarize what has been said. (4) Before beginning another idea or


point

< br>,


it



s necessary to inform students of this change or transition.


Students are reluctant to continually ask teachers to repeat what they’ve said,


even when they haven't completely understood the teacher. (5) Thus, it is important


for teachers to frequently stop to if students have any questions. (6) Another method


often used by both international and American teachers is presenting the same idea in


more than one way.


Many effective teachers learn to elicit the help of their students. (7) If the teacher


and students have a friendly relationship, students usually are more willing to help


facilitate communication in the classroom. In the following statement a teacher from


Iran described how he uses certain teaching methods to be sure his students


understand him.



I



ve been trying hard to say the words separate so that students can understand.


(8) Once in a while I stop and ask,



Do you follow?



and pretty much make them feel


that any time they can stop me.
